Mogadishu, Somalia – On May 28, 2025, the President of Somalia, Hassan Sheikh Mohamud, reappointed Hassan Mohamed Hussein, popularly known as Muungaab, as the Governor of Banaadir Region and Mayor of Mogadishu.This appointment followed a recommendation from the Ministry of Interior, Federal Affairs and Reconciliation to remove the former Governor of Banaadir, Mohamed Ahmed Amir.Hassan Mohamed Hussein (Muungaab) has held several key positions within the Somali government. He previously served as the Chairman of the Military Court, Governor of Banaadir Region, Mayor of Mogadishu, and Deputy Minister of Justice.Muungaab holds a PhD degree in Law from Omdurman University in Sudan, where he also completed his other academic qualifications.The former governor, Mohamed Ahmed Amir, served from December 10, 2024, after succeeding Madale, who held the position twice before.Profile of Hassan Mohamed Hussein (Muungaab):Born in 1972 in Kigasho, Warsheekh District, Middle Shabelle Region.Appointed Chairman of the Supreme Military Court in 2014.Also appointed Governor of Banaadir Region in 2014.Founder of the Justice and Development Party of Somalia.Graduated in 2002 from the International University of Africa, Faculty of Sharia and Islamic Studies, earning a first degree. Later obtained a Master’s and PhD in Law from Omdurman University, Sudan.
